How much is the Claflin tuition? For the academic year 2023-2024, Claflin's tuition & fees is $17,046.
With indirect costs not billed by school, such as room & boards and personal living expenses, the total cost of attendance for one academic year is $33,676 when a student lives on-campus.

How Much Does it Cost to Go to Claflin for 4 Years?
For the class of 2027, who entering colleges in 2023, the 4 years tuition & fees is $68,184 at Claflin. The estimated tuition rate is based on the changes over last 5 years. With room & board, books, and other personal expenses, the estimated 4 years costs of attendance is $127,104. After receiving financial aid including grants, scholarships, and/or student loans, the 4 years COA is down to $68,752.

Tuition Trends Over Past 10 Years
The undergraduate tuition & fees of Claflin University has increased by 13.56% over the past 10 years from $15,010 to $17,046. The graduate tuition & fee has increased by 8.36% from $10,070 to $10,912.
The living costs increased by 0.00% last year and -5.21% over the past 10 years.
Financial Aid and COA
At Claflin University, 1,744 students (98%) received grant or scholarship from the federal government, state or local government, the institution, and other sources. The average amount of grant/scholarship received is $14,588.
After receiving financial aid, the cost of attendance (COA) at Claflin is $19,088 for students living on-campus and $24,858 for students living off-campus.
For beginning students (i.e. first-time freshmen), 302 students received any type of financial aid including grants/scholarship and student loans. The average amount of grant/scholarship for the first-time students is $13,707 and the average amount of student loans is $6,417.
The financial aid data is based on 2021-2022 statistics from IPEDS.
Admission Stats and Requirements to Apply
Claflin's acceptance rate is 62.47%. A total of 8,467 applicants applied to and 5,289 students were accepted. Of the admitted students, 315 enrolled finally, and the yield (i.e. enrollment rate) is 5.96%.
To apply to Claflin, 2 items are required - Secondary school GPA and Secondary school record and 4 items are recommended to submit - Secondary school rank, Completion of college-preparatory program, Admission test scores and T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language).
Student Population
Claflin University has a total of 1,830 students including 1,749 undergraduate and 81 graduate students. By gender, there are 544 male students and 1,322 female students attending Claflin. The school offers online degree programs and 187 students enrolled online exclusively (10.22% of all students).
